CONTENTS NOTE
Text of Note
Transforming students' learning : how digital technologies could be used to change the social practices of schools -- Meaning-making and the appropriation of geometric reasoning : computer mediated support for understanding the relationship between area and perimeter of parallelograms -- What could be? creativity in digitized classrooms -- Distributed teacher collaboration : organizational tensions and innovations mediated by instant messaging -- Rethinking the principles of personalisation and the role of digital technologies -- 'Learning networks' -- capacity building for school development and ICT -- The digital didactic -- Use of technology in education : didactic challenges -- Using videopapers to communicate and represent practice in postgraduate education programmes -- Copying with computers : information management or cheating and plagarism? -- Learning in the network society as an ideal for learning in school -- Challenges and opportunities in digital assessment -- Multivoiced e-feedback in the study of law : enhancing learning opportunities? -- The need for rethinking communicative competence -- Intergenerational encounters -- digital activities in family settings -- If innovation by means of educational technology is the answer -- what should the question be? -- Epilogue : Productive horizontal learning and digital tools.
